What Yarn is Best for Knitting Frog and Toad?

Selecting the right yarn is crucial for achieving the desired texture and look of your Frog and Toad. Soft, plush yarns like worsted weight or DK weight are ideal. Consider using a yarn that is:

  • Soft and cuddly: Choose a yarn that's gentle on the skin, making your finished plushies perfect for snuggling. Look for blends of wool, acrylic, or cotton that provide a soft feel.
  • Easy to work with: Opt for a yarn that's not overly fuzzy or prone to splitting, which can make knitting more challenging.
  • Color appropriate: You’ll want a green yarn for the frog and a brown or beige yarn for the toad. Consider a variegated yarn for added texture and visual interest.

What Size Needles Should I Use for My Frog and Toad?

The needle size you choose will depend on the yarn you select and the pattern you use. Most patterns will specify the recommended needle size. However, as a general guideline, using needles between US size 6 and 8 (4mm to 5mm) will likely be appropriate for worsted or DK weight yarn.

Remember, using slightly smaller needles will result in a tighter fabric, while using slightly larger needles will create a looser fabric. Experimenting might be necessary to achieve the desired look.

What are some Common Mistakes to Avoid When Knitting Frog and Toad?

  • Inconsistent Tension: Maintaining even tension is key to a well-proportioned and attractive finished product. Practice your knit and purl stitches to ensure consistency.
  • Incorrect Stitch Counts: Double-check your stitch count regularly to catch any errors before they become larger problems.
  • Rushing the Process: Take your time and focus on each stitch to avoid mistakes. Knitting should be enjoyable; rushing can lead to frustration.

How Can I Add Details to My Frog and Toad Plushies?

Once you’ve completed knitting your Frog and Toad, you can add extra details to make them even more charming:

  • Embroidery: Use embroidery floss to add eyes, mouths, and other facial features.
  • Safety Eyes: For added security, especially if the plushies are for young children, consider using safety eyes.
  • Stuffing: Use fiberfill stuffing to give your Frog and Toad a plump and cuddly feel.
